  • Cancellation Policy: Can I cancel my StraighterLine Membership before all my assignments are graded?

    Yes. If you have completed your coursework, you may cancel your membership before your final assignment(s) are graded and a final grade is posted to your course.

    If you need to resubmit an assignment based on feedback or do not pass the course and wish to retake it, you will need to renew your membership to regain access.

  • Cancellation Policy: How do I cancel My Membership?

    To cancel your membership, follow these steps:

    1. Log in to your student dashboard and click the Account Settings icon on the left side of your screen.
    2. Select Billing Preferences and complete the Membership Cancellation process.
    3. Once your cancellation is processed, you will receive a confirmation email. Be sure to note the date your billing cycle ends, as this will be the last day you can access your courses.

  • Cancellation Policy: Do I have access to my course(s) after I cancel my StraighterLine Membership?

    If you cancel your membership, you will retain access to your courses until the end of your billing cycle. If you cancel before your next billing date, your access will continue until that date.

    For example, if you cancel on September 2nd and your next billing date is September 17th, you will have 15 days of continued course access before your account fully expires.

  • Cancellation Policy: What happens if I cancel my StraighterLine membership without completing my course(s)?

    If you cancel your membership before completing your courses, your progress will be saved and can be resumed when you return, provided the course has not expired. If the course has expired, you will need to upgrade to the latest version before continuing.

    Note: To request an upgrade for an expired course, email support@straighterline.com with the subject "Course Upgrade Request." Please allow 3-5 business days for the Support Team to respond to your request.

    By submitting a Course Upgrade Request, you are selecting to be moved to a new version. Be advised: American Council on Education (ACE) compliance does not permit us to transfer grades from one course version to another. Therefore, course upgrades will result in the loss of any previous progress.

    Course Upgrades are free of charge and will not impact your membership.

  • Cancellation Policy: Can I cancel at any time?

    There is no long-term commitment with StraighterLine.

    You can start or stop your Monthly Membership at any time and restart when you are ready.
